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
271734570 604099677 153519
680 360949
680 360949
533515903 135828151 8085
All about undefined
Interested in learning more?
680 360949
533515903 135828151 8085
See more
244 01745975
57 70598651962 4573214321
See more
3580 52 49
314736 032900474 1306 8599
See more